The New York Sky Put on Quite a Show Last Night


A major solar storm made the famous Northern Lights faintly visible in the New York–area sky last night, creating the perfect opportunity to snap some #nofilter ‘grams. New Yorkers who followed our plan and got out of the city to a dark, deserted area were treated to some pretty spectacular views.